Very Wierd Electrical Issue
I have an issue that is puzzling me. I parked my blazer for 2 days and after heavy rain, no flooding, from hurricane sandy here in mass it wouldnt crank/start. I got it turned the key on everything lit up, turned to start and boom everything OUT, then after that I turn the key and get dim and minimal lights in the dash, dinger stays steady and sounds wierd. I hooked up jumper cables, it cranked hard but started. ran great, shut off and started hard again with jumpers, but with just the battery it wont do anything. I drove it home and while driving home it ran and drove great but all the suddon the all the lights came on just like i had turned the key on. went through normal startup process and all gauges went back to normal. got it home, still wouldnt start on its own, locks act like very low power, tried with a differant battery and same problem. rear hatch popped itself open at one point. anyone know what it could be? I dont want to keep changing parts until I find it, hopefully someone has an idea!

Sounds like you have a ground short because of moisture.
Something is grounding out & causing electrical demons!
Might be a ground wire, check the fuse box under hood for wet connections as well, the connections to the alternator & starter. Are the battery terminals clean & solid?
